Effect of Sunlight Strength



Occasionally, the intensity of sunshine can considerably influence the performance of solar panels. When the sunlight is solid and straight, your solar panels create more electricity. Nevertheless, during gloomy days or when the sun is at a low angle, the panels get less sunshine, minimizing their effectiveness. To make best use of the power outcome of your solar panels, it's vital to mount them in areas with ample sunlight exposure throughout the day. Take into consideration variables like shading from neighboring trees or buildings that might obstruct sunshine and reduce the panels' efficiency.

To maximize the efficiency of your solar panels, consistently tidy them to eliminate any kind of dust, dirt, or particles that may be blocking sunshine absorption. Additionally, ensure that your panels are tilted properly to obtain one of the most straight sunlight possible.

Impact of Temperature Adjustments



When temperature level adjustments take place, they can have a substantial effect on the performance of photovoltaic panels. Photovoltaic panel work finest in cooler temperature levels, making them extra reliable on mild days compared to extremely warm ones. As the temperature level increases, solar panels can experience a reduction in performance because of a sensation known as the temperature coefficient. This effect creates a reduction in voltage outcome, inevitably impacting the general power manufacturing of the panels.

Duty of Cloud Cover and Rainfall



Cloud cover and rainfall can considerably impact the performance of photovoltaic panels. When clouds obstruct the sun, the amount of sunlight reaching your photovoltaic panels is lowered, leading to a reduction in energy manufacturing. Rainfall can also impact solar panel effectiveness by blocking sunlight and creating a layer of dirt or grime on the panels, additionally decreasing their capability to create electricity. Also light rainfall can scatter sunlight, triggering it to be less concentrated on the panels.



Throughout overcast days with heavy cloud cover, solar panels might experience a substantial decrease in power result. Nonetheless, it deserves keeping in mind that some modern photovoltaic panel modern technologies can still create power even when the sky is gloomy. Additionally, rain can have a cleaning effect on photovoltaic panels, getting rid of dirt and dust that may have collected gradually.
